Replacement Therapy (CRRT)DIANOVA X2 represents Dialife’s latest generation of machines. It offers advanced technology, therapy options, and monitoring features while preserving unmatched user-friendliness.
Some of DIANOVA features include:

- Flat, rotating 15-inch touch screen for
- increased readability and convenience.
Ingenious, user-friendly software with a high degree of monitoring and personalization. - Automated, online priming without the use of serum nor personnel intervention.
- Heparin pump designed for multiple syringe sizes with automated syringe size detection, self-test alarm system, and heparin profiling.
- VP air detector with a dual ultrasonic and optical monitoring system for precise bubble catching, safe blood return, and continuous micro-bubble detection.
- Endotoxin filtration system: Double-stage on DIANOVA X2 model for HDF online.
- 40 min backup battery in the event of a power outage.
- Facilitated maintenance through smart maintenance mode and clear, simplified organization of electric and hydraulic compartments.

Comprehensive Monitoring
ONLINE KT/V MONITORING
Ensures proper dialysis dose is delivered in real-time.
BLOOD PRESSURE MONITORING
Automated and non-invasive system to control blood pressure.
BLOOD VOLUME MONITORING
Allows ultrafiltration monitoring according to blood volume variations.
BLOOD TEMPERATURE MONITORING
Сontrols body temperature to ensure hemodynamic balance.
NETWORK MONITORING
Interface to connect to renal unit software for centralized data management; USB port also available as an alternative to downloading data.
